## Step 4: Audit for leaked descriptors

Before upgrading to Fernwick SDK 3.0, plugin authors must verify that every handle obtained from the Quillbase runtime is explicitly released. The new supervisor terminates plugins holding descriptors past the drain window, so sweep your teardown paths carefully, including error branches. To reproduce the enforcement behavior locally, run the sandbox with the exact settings below.

service settings:
PRAIX_LOG_LEVEL=error
PRAIX_METRICS_HOST=metrics.praix.qorvelcorp.corp
PRAIX_POOL_SIZE=16

## Shard Migration: Profile Store

When splitting the Murkwell profile store, always drain the write queue on the Ostenfeld replica first, then snapshot each shard candidate and verify row counts match the ledger within tolerance. Rebalancing must run during the low-traffic window. The migration worker authenticates against the shard coordinator, so before starting it, add this line to its environment file:

sealed setting: ARCHIVE_KEY3=8d0

Subject: Cold start measurements for the Vantrel handlers

Release channel: as part of the security review, we re-measured cold starts after trimming the dependency tree in the Vantrel serverless handlers. P95 cold start dropped from 2.1s to 0.9s with no change to the permission set. Audit logs confirm no new network egress during init. The measured build is identified by the token below.

pipeline stamp: htk31_f769b577b3028a4e9958e5bb8d1259a

# Thumbnail Queue Approvals

Welcome! Anything touching the Pixelbarn thumbnail queue needs a quick approval before merge — yes, even config tweaks. Post your change in the queue-reviews channel, wait for a thumbs-up, then ship. Resizes and format changes get extra scrutiny because they can flood the workers. The person who gives the final sign-off on all queue changes is listed here.

signatory, yagap-bawig: Ulaath Eliath